Job Description:

Overview of department:

Our team, at our Bristol facility, develop solutions for the next generation of Air Defence Systems; developing evolving products whilst maintaining our enviable reputation for safety, performance and dependability.

Responsibilities:

To produce a software Console product, replacing an existing version with better software architecture making the product more maintainable and verifiable going forward. This is not an up-date, but a remake – this is estimated to a minimum of 12 month’s work. The task is primarily an independent solo task, but based within a team for support/input and to ensure that the resulting product operates within the intended system.

Skillset/experience required:

  • A strong background in software engineering, its realisation and system wide impact.
  • Experience of working in C++ and QT
  • Collaborative, open approach to application development and have the ability to maintain momentum during development.
  • Experience of working across the entire software development process from engaging with requirement authorities to automated proving, supported with effective documentation
  • Experience of new tools, techniques and approaches that might enable us to evolve our processes to improve our efficiency and sustainability
  • Experience in other languages such as Ada, QT
  • Knowledge of DDS and multi-threaded applications.
  • Knowledge of standards such as DefStan 00-55, DO-178C or IEC61508 and restricted coding standards such as MISRA C++
